Sinner vs Djokovic Prediction — Wimbledon 2026 Semifinal Pick
Jannik Sinner meets Novak Djokovic in the Wimbledon 2026 semifinals — a rematch of last year's semi, which Sinner won in straight sets before lifting the title. The books make Sinner 1.20–1.25 on the moneyline: chalk below our 1.60 floor, so the room bet the shape of the match instead. The pick: Sinner -5.5 games @ 2.00 (Pinnacle).
The physical case
Sinner hasn't dropped a set since a first-round scare and cruised through his quarterfinal. Djokovic, 39, has dropped five sets in five matches and needed five hours and five sets to get past Auger-Aliassime, taking a medical timeout for his calf along the way. The Believer's read: a torch that already got passed — Sinner in straights.
The dissent
The Skeptic isn't arguing the winner. His problem is blowout lines on a man who has spent twenty years turning tired legs into tiebreaks: Sinner 3-1, long sets, and his own bet is Over 38 games.
The math
The Quant makes Sinner -5.5 games 54.5% against a no-vig fair near 48.5% — roughly +6 points of edge at Pinnacle's 2.00 — while the Over prices as a coin flip with no edge. The handicap is the play, and the Skeptic's dissent is named on the record.
